Завис сайт. Необходима помощь.

Завис сайт. Необходима помощь.

от Илья Ход -
Количество ответов: 13

moodle 2.8  

Тема: sanflawer

--------------------

По ошибке не вставил завершающий тег </STYLE>...

Вставлял дополнительный код:


<STYLE type="text/css">

.ramka{

    border: 1px solid #0E5CB1;

    margin-bottom: 10px;

    padding-bottom: 10px;

    background-color: #FFF;

    border-radius:10px; /* Радиус скругления углов*/

    -webkit-box-shadow: 7px 7px 6px -6px #0E5CB1;

    -moz-box-shadow: 7px 7px 6px -6px #0E5CB1;

    box-shadow: 7px 7px 6px -6px #0E5CB1;

    -webkit-box-shadow: 7px 7px 6px -6px #0E5CB1; /* Safari, Chrome */

    -moz-box-shadow: 7px 7px 6px -6px #0E5CB1; /* Firefox */

    hover{border:4px solid #f77;  /* Меняет цвет при наведении */

}

</STYLE>

И по неосторожности забыл в конце вставить завершающий тег  </STYLE>

В результате сайт завис...

Друзья.  Подскажите где этот код искать.

Все перерыл...



В ответ на Илья Ход

Re: Завис сайт. Необходима помощь.

от Vladimir Zuev -

Если Вы вставляли в настройках темы пользовательские стили CSS, то теги <style> и </style> там вообще не нужны. Не знаю, может ли от этого зависнуть сайт, но данные настройки хранятся в базе данных. Если не ошибаюсь - в таблице вашпрефикс_config_plugins. Поищите по названию темы оформления...

В ответ на Vladimir Zuev

Re: Завис сайт. Необходима помощь.

от Илья Ход -

Он работал с тегами <style> и </style> до того, как я изменения делал...

Сейчас в БД искать начну.

Сайт pol.34pro.ru  в коде страницы видно. Между <HEAD> и </HEAD>, что нет завершающего тега </style>

В ответ на Илья Ход

Re: Завис сайт. Необходима помощь.

от Илья Ход -

Вот у меня из таблицы БД mdl_config_plugins

Таблица:   mdl_config_plugins

ID        NAME            PLUGIN         VALUE     

2     maxsections    moodlecourse     52
3     numsections    moodlecourse     10
4     hiddensections    moodlecourse     0
5     newsitems    moodlecourse     5
6     showgrades    moodlecourse     1
7     showreports    moodlecourse     0
8     maxbytes    moodlecourse     16777216
9     groupmode    moodlecourse     1
10     groupmodeforce    moodlecourse     0
11     visible    moodlecourse     1
12     lang    moodlecourse    
13     enablecompletion    moodlecourse     0
14     completionstartonenrol    moodlecourse     0
15     loglifetime    backup     30
16     backup_general_users    backup     1
17     backup_general_users_locked    backup     0
18     backup_general_anonymize    backup     0
19     backup_general_anonymize_locked    backup     0
20     backup_general_role_assignments    backup     1
21     backup_general_role_assignments_locked    backup     0
22     backup_general_activities    backup     1
23     backup_general_activities_locked    backup     0
24     backup_general_blocks    backup     1
25     backup_general_blocks_locked    backup     0
26     backup_general_filters    backup     1
27     backup_general_filters_locked    backup     0
28     backup_general_comments    backup     1
29     backup_general_comments_locked    backup     0
30     backup_general_userscompletion    backup     1

---------------------------------

Не знаю куда дальше "копать"...

---------------------------

Нашел файл с проблемным кодом, который вставлял, вот по этому пути:

/moodledata/cache/cachestore_file/default_application/core_config/6cf-cache/6cfda020daa8d1fc1afb2dd4368d28a793b0e798.cache

Удаляю этот код, сохраняю - ничего не получается!

Вставляю завершающий тег </style>    -   не получается...

Не знаю как быть.

Подскажите    грущу

В ответ на Илья Ход

Re: Завис сайт. Необходима помощь.

от Vladimir Zuev -

1. Я Вас правильно понял - вышеупомянутый код Вы вставляли в поле Доп. слили CSS в настройках своей темы?

2. Если так, то Вы на верном пути. Но Вы привели только первые 30 строк из таблицы. Там их гораздо больше. Например, для моей темы данные настройки находятся в строке 1218

Если п. 1 не так, то как?

P/S: Речь идет о сайте http://pol.34pro.ru/ ? У меня он прекрасно работает...

В ответ на Vladimir Zuev

Re: Завис сайт. Необходима помощь.

от Илья Ход -
В ответ на Илья Ход

Re: Завис сайт. Необходима помощь.

от Илья Ход -

На рабочем сайте зашел вот сюда:

Администрирование/Внешний вид/Дополнительный HTML

В поле

"В тег HEAD"

Ввел вышеупомянутый код.

Сохранил. - Всё пропало...

В ответ на Илья Ход

Re: Завис сайт. Необходима помощь.

от Vladimir Zuev -

Ну тогда концепция меняется. Надо искать в таблице вашпрефикс_config

Параметр additionalhtmlhead в строке примерно 307 (для Moodle 2.9)


В ответ на Vladimir Zuev

Re: Завис сайт. Необходима помощь.

от Илья Ход -

Нашел.

-------------------------------------------------

<meta name="description" content="ЦПОиА. Обучение оценщиков в Волгограде.">
улыбаюсь
   
<!-- RedHelper -->
<script id="rhlpscrtg" type="text/javascript" charset="utf-8" async="async"
    src="https://web.redhelper.ru/service/main.js?c=raa">
</script>
<!--/Redhelper -->

----------------------------------------------------------------

В том месте, где я сейчас вставил смайлик, я располагал проблемный код.

Но, его тут нет.

В ответ на Vladimir Zuev

Re: Завис сайт. Необходима помощь.

от Vladimir Zuev -

Стало интересно. Воспроизвел Вашу ошибку. Действительно всё так и есть.

Очистка поля additionalhtmlhead в базе данных помогла. Но после очистки необходимо почистить кэш вручную. Для этого удалить всё содержимое папки moodledata/cache/

В ответ на Vladimir Zuev

Re: Завис сайт. Необходима помощь.

от Илья Ход -

В  additionalhtmlhead в базе данных  ничего не чистил. (там нет проблемного кода).

В папке moodledata/cache/   находятся три папки и файл  core_component.php

Удалить все файлы в moodledata/cache/  ?

И при запросе сформируются новые данные в этой папке. Верно?

В ответ на Илья Ход

Re: Завис сайт. Необходима помощь.

от Илья Ход -

Владимир Вам "стопитсот" плюсов!

Очень помогли. Огромнейшее спасибо!!!

Я бы очень долго разбирался.

Всё работает.

Спасибо за помощь!